From the Peptide Explorer
A tetrapeptide based on the pineal gland peptide epithalamine, developed by Professor Vladimir Khavinson at the St. Petersburg Institute of Biogerontology. Epithalon is the most-studied telomerase activator of peptide origin, with research spanning over 35 years in the Khavinson laboratory.
Key Mechanisms
- ›Telomerase (hTERT) activation
- ›Telomere elongation
- ›Melatonin secretion normalization
- ›Pineal gland function restoration
- ›Circadian rhythm regulation
Primary Research Areas
- ›Telomere biology
- ›Aging research
- ›Circadian rhythm
- ›Melatonin regulation
- ›Lifespan extension
Key Research Findings
- Activated telomerase in human somatic cells, extending telomere length (Khavinson et al., 2003)
- Extended median lifespan by 13.3% in aged mice (Anisimov et al., 2003)
- Restored melatonin secretion patterns in aged primates
